G'day,
 
On a side note regarding voltage and PSG-1: With the 200% spring and a 10.8v custom battery, my PSG-1 would fire two round bursts. The innards were spinning so fast, the piston would fail to catch at the end of the cycle and fire a 2nd time. Next trigger pull would result in just cranking the piston back to firing position. So, 1st trigger pull = 1.5 cycles, 2nd pull = .5 cycle. It was fun, but we decided to remove the extra cells and now all is well with 8.4v. Just something to be aware of if you go with a custom battery.

What gears were you using for that upgrade?

What you're describing sounds like a problem you'd get with standard ratio gears with too much voltage. What happens is that the increased ROF will cause the motor to overtorque and because the spring is not excessively heavy, it doesn't stop the overtorqued gears, and thus, rotating past the stop point.

It's an imbalanced setup.

Even with the 300% spring, I was powering it with a 12V and Systema Magnum motor. I'm sure the same setup can crank a 400% spring, but you'll definitely have some serious durability issues in the long run.

If you want velocities so high, why not just pick up a Tanaka M700 series bolt action rifle and install the G&G Power bolt? You'll easily hit 800fps with propane, and it'll save you tons of money and headaches.... it will also perform much better. Bolt actions are inherently more accurate and quieter. The only feature you lose is the semi-auto fire.

As a field gun, the PSG-1 is one of the worst guns to do up, due to the wobbly body and the inherent limitations of applying high velocity upgrades to the auto-electric system. I always tell this to all my clients who request to do the upgrade: Unless you REALLY LOVE the PSG-1, it's a lot of wasted money to achieve a goal that you can get elsewhere for better and cheaper. There's a certain coolness factor versus cost benefit ratio that needs to be weighed on the owner's mind.

As cool as I think the PSG-1 system is, I can't honestly see myself ever using that gun as a field gun.

We're talking about PSG-1's here. Not standard AEGs.

The function is opposite, where the piston stays cocked in the off cycle. It allows for instantaneous shots on trigger pull. The wind up cycle occurs after the piston is released.

This is why PSG-1 upgrades require so much torque - being able to crank an already cocked spring from a resting position requires way more current and torque than normal functioning AEGs do.

If you're going to push the velocity up that high, I highly recommend you installing a MOSFET. If you don't, you're going to burn holes in to your switch assembly due to the huge electrical arcing that occurs with current draw that large.
Once you burn out your switch contacts... good luck getting a replacement. :P
